________________ C4. Has God appeared on earth? One of the three Divine Persons, the Son or the "Word” (Logos) of God, entered human history by becoming a man, Jesus Christ, born by virginal conception in the womb of the Blessed Virgin Mary. C5. What are the principal attributes of God? God is the source of all things; God is the creator from nothing of all things that exist. The Scriptures mention many attributes of God, such as mercy, justice, compassion, wisdom, omniscience, omnipotence, eternal, present everywhere and so forth; these are all understood to be analogous to the truth about God's nature, because human language can at best only point in the right direction with the help of God. Human language does not fully describe the attributes of God. D. SCRIPTURE D1. What are the main scriptures? What language? The Catholic Church received the Hebrew Scriptures as they were known to Jesus and the Apostles. In preaching about Jesus Christ, the early Christian community made use of the Septuagint, an expanded version of the Hebrew Scriptures containing Greek translations of Hebrew and Aramaic works as well as several works composed by Jews in Greek. The New Testament consists of 27 early Christian writings, all of which were composed in Greek. D2. What is their origin? The human authors of these works are believed to have been inspired by the Holy Spirit. Moreover, the selection of these works was also guided by the Holy Spirit to insure that they authentically convey the teachings of Jesus and the apostles; these works were read during the early Christian celebration of the Eucharist. An important witness to this process of selection is St. Ignatius of Antioch, who was martyred in about 110 A.D. He had been a bishop in Asia Minor for more than three decades, the very period in which the New Testament works were composed; in his letters, he deliberately restricts his citations to the works in the New Testament except the Book of Revelation.
